My astro gear

Don't think I've posted a shot of my telescope. Here are some shots I took of it at Astrofest this year.

This shows the main imaging scope, a 10" Newtonian, on the computerised German Equatorial Mount. On top of the imaging scope is a smaller guide scope that is used to track accurately during long exposures. In the black toolbox is power and data hub.
